Abstract
The normal (NFD) and tangential contact forces (TFD) between viscoelastic ellipsoidal particles are studied based on the contact mechanics and finite element method. It is found that the NFD and TFD force models previously formulated for spheres are valid for ellipsoidal particles and non-spherical particles of smooth surface, provided that some variables in the models are properly considered. The applicability of the NFD and TFD models are demonstrated in the collisions of two viscoelastic ellipsoids and shown to agree well with the results calculated by means of the finite element method. As part of the study, the applicability of the Linear-Spring-Dashpot (LSD) model which is widely used in the discrete modeling is also examined, and its limitation is identified.
